Whether your new wig from Target is synthetic or human-hair, proper care will extend its lifespan. For synthetic wigs purchased from mass-market retailers like Target: avoid high heat unless the wig is heat-friendly, use wig-specific shampoo and conditioner, detangle gently with a wide-tooth comb designed for wigs, and store on a wig stand to maintain shape. For human-hair pieces, follow higher-end care routines: sulfate-free cleansing, deep conditioning, heat-protection products and occasional professional styling when needed. Remember that product pages will usually indicate fiber type and care instructions — read them before washing or styling.

Target generally lists cap size information for wigs sold online. Standard categories are petite, average/regular and large. To ensure fit, measure head circumference (forehead to nape to ear and around) and compare to the product’s size chart. If a wig feels loose, adjustable straps and internal combs can help secure fit; otherwise consult a wig specialist for custom fitting or alterations.

Target often stocks complementary wig accessories including caps, adhesive tapes, wig stands, headbands and styling tools safe for synthetic hair. Purchasing a wig cap can create a smoother base and help with grip; adhesives and tapes are useful if you need extra security for lace fronts. If buying styling tools, confirm compatibility with the wig’s fiber type to avoid melting or damage.

Q: Can I return a wig to Target if it doesn’t fit?
A: Target’s return policy depends on the item condition and vendor; unopened and unused wigs are typically returnable within the policy window, but opened or worn wigs may be treated as non-returnable for hygiene reasons. Always check the product page for return eligibility before purchasing.
Q: Does Target sell lace front wigs?
A: Occasionally — lace front constructions appear in Target’s online catalog and larger stores, though availability varies. Use the site filters to search specifically for “lace front” or “lace” to locate these items.
Q: Are wigs at Target suitable for daily wear?
A: Some synthetic and higher-quality heat-friendly wigs can be comfortable for frequent wear, but for daily, long-term use, many people prefer human-hair options or premium wig lines that offer better longevity and realism.
